                    The exporting mentioned on the Thea for Sketchup page is simply an option to export to Thea Studio.

                    There is no need to export and you can use Thea without leaving Sketchup - just as you can with Vray, Twighlight or the other integrated rendering software.

                                          It's all the same thing.

                                          Thea standalone (studio) is the rendering software you buy, which includes Presto as one of the various render options. You then need the Thea4SU plugin to use Thea inside SU (including the GPU+CPU Presto option).
